Write an equation for an ellipse centered at the origin, which has foci at (\pm8,0)(±8,0)left parenthesis, plus minus, 8, comma,
mario62 [17]

Answer:

The equation of the ellipse is \frac{x^{2}}{(17)^{2}}+\frac{y^{2}}{(15)^{2}}=1

Step-by-step explanation:

The standard form of the equation of an ellipse with center (0 , 0) is

\frac{x^{2}}{a^{2}}+\frac{y^{2}}{b^{2}}=1 , where

  • The coordinates of the vertices are (± a , 0)  
  • The coordinates of the foci are (± c , 0) , where c ² = a² - b²  

∵ The ellipse is centered at the origin

∴ The center of it is (0 , 0)

∵ It has foci at (± 8 , 0)

- The coordinates of the foci are (± c , 0)

∴ c = ±8

∵ It has Vertices at (± 17 , 0)

- The coordinates of the vertices are (± a , 0)

∴ a = ±17

∵ c² = a² - b²

- Substitute the values of c and a to find b

∴ (8)² = (17)² - b²

∴ 64 = 289 - b²

- Add b² to both sides

∴ b² + 64 = 289

- Subtract 64 from both sides

∴ b² = 225

- Take √  for both sides

∴ b = ± 15

∵ The equation of the ellipse is \frac{x^{2}}{a^{2}}+\frac{y^{2}}{b^{2}}=1

- Substitute the values of a and b in it

∴ \frac{x^{2}}{(17)^{2}}+\frac{y^{2}}{(15)^{2}}=1 ⇒ \frac{x^{2}}{289}+\frac{y^{2}}{225}=1  

∴ The equation of the ellipse is \frac{x^{2}}{(17)^{2}}+\frac{y^{2}}{(15)^{2}}=1

Amaya's test scores in Algebra 1 are 78 and 91. She has one more test left and wants to earn a B for the course, which is from 8
ICE Princess25 [194]
Let x be the score Amaya gets on the final test. She wants her average of all 3 tests to be between 80 and 89: 

<span>80 ≤ (78 + 91 + x) / 3 ≤ 89 </span>

<span>Multiply everything by 3: </span>
<span>240 ≤ 78 + 91 + x ≤ 267 </span>
<span>240 ≤ 169 + x ≤ 267 </span>

<span>Subtract 169 from everything: </span>
<span>240 - 169 ≤ x ≤ 267 - 169 </span>
<span>71 ≤ x ≤ 98 </span>

<span>Answer: </span>
<span>She needs to score between 71 and 98 to get a B for the course.</span>
